I can export a .m3u playlist from Audirvana 3.5.x and import it into Audirvana.  An iTunes playlist that is exported has an initial line with "#EXTM3U" which is not present in an Audirvana export.  But removing that line does not fix the importing problem.  Even if I copy over the other content of the iTunes playlist to an Audirvana exported playlist file and save it, I cannot import the edited file.

 

If I export an Audirvana playlist, then import it to iTunes it plays fine, but if I then export it from iTunes, I cannot import it back into Audirvana (with or without that opening line).

 

Weird!

On 5/29/2019 at 2:27 PM, JML said:

Has anyone tried to use True-Fi from Soundworks (preset equalization for specific headphones) together with Audirvana 3.5.x?  I downloaded the trial version, and the application shows up in Audirvana along with other DACs, but I cannot get it it to work with my external Oppo HA-1 DAC/Amp connected via USB. Audirvana gives me a choice of one output target, and the True-Fi support site says only to turn off "Exclusive Access" in Audirvana, but that doesn't work to get signal to the Oppo.

 

I got True-Fi to work by turning off the SysOptimizer in Audirvana (in addition to Exclusive Access).
